Just thought I'd post this little snippet from the Feb 07 issue of Empire magazine - it seems Elijah had a hand in choosing LL as his 'bride':

Emilio Estevez: "Lindsay's agents kept pushing her. I'd heard horrible stories, so I said 'Is she interested in being thought of as a serious actress? Because this schedule can't support anyone misbehaving.' 'They assured me 'Yes, she wants to meet with you'. So I called Elijah (Wood, who plays her fiance) and said 'I need you to come to lunch today'. I wanted another opinion, especially from the actor who would be in most of her scenes. It ended up as a love-fest. We laughed, told stories, she understood the script and the role and was committed. She left, and Elijah and I looked at each other and said 'She'd be fabulous'."

The Golden Globes just announced that Bobby has been nominated for "Best Drama"!

http://abclocal.go.com/kabc/story?section=entertainment&id=4851193

BEVERLY HILLS, December 14, 2006 - The multinational ensemble drama "Babel" led Golden Globe contenders Thursday with seven nominations including best dramatic picture and acting honors for Brad Pitt and Rinko Kikuchi.
Also nominated for best dramatic picture: the Robert Kennedy story "Bobby," the mob tale "The Departed," the suburban drama "Little Children" and the royalty-in-crisis "The Queen."

Oh! Also, Happy Feet was nominated for Best Animated film. This link shows most of the nominations, if not all:

http://www.cnn.com/2006/SHOWBIZ/Movies/12/14/globe.nominations/index.html?section=cnn_latest

"Cars," "Happy Feet" and "Monster House" all earned nominations for best animated film.

The winners will be announced at the awards ceremony, scheduled for January 15.
